Tuesday, March 18, 2008 - 08:44 PM Firefox 3 uses less memory than Internet Explorer, Opera
Posted by: Scott
Ars Technica has a nice article where they talk about the latest tests done on Firefox 3, Internet Explorer 7, Opera, and Firefox 2 comparing memory usage. The results are promising, with Firefox 3 using only half the memory of Firefox 2 under heavy testing (50 tabs).
